Netcetera Celebrates Its 15th Anniversary

by isleofman.com 1st September 2011
Netcetera announces celebrations and promotions for its 15th Anniversary Ballasalla, Isle of Man, 31 August 2011 - Founded in August 1996, Isle of Man based Netcetera has grown to become one of the world’s leading hosting service providers. Today, customers range from home and small business users to government agencies and global e-business enterprises in more than 60 countries. To celebrate their success over the last 15 years and to thank their customers for their contribution, they have proudly announced the launch of a number of fantastic competitions and promotions during the coming month. During the past 15 years, Netcetera has achieved many momentous milestones. To develop into the business that it is today, Netcetera has evolved in many areas, and amongst them is the investment of ?10 million in a world-class Datacenter, The DataPort, in Ballasalla in April 2007. As acknowledgment of this impressive track record, Netcetera has scooped several accolades in recent years: - A Microsoft Gold Certified Partner with a Competency in Hosting – being a Microsoft Certified Partner since 1999. - Listed in the Deloitte 50 Fastest Growing Technology Companies three years running. - Ranked as the UK’s best performing Web Host by Internet Research specialists, Netcraft. - Rated No.1 in their monthly poll by hosting portal TopHosts. - Voted No.1 by The Web Host Directory, the global hosting industry portal. - In 2011, became the winner for Best Shared Hosting in the UK Internet ISPA Awards. - In July 2011 Netcetera was the Most Reliable Windows Hosting Company Worldwide.
